Nigerian international Yakubu is the latest big name to sign up for the MarathonBet #NonLeagueChallenge Legends match on Sunday 29th July.

Yakubu, 35, has been capped 57 times by his country, Nigeria, scoring 21 goals.

He moved into English football at Portsmouth from Maccabi Haifa, for whom he had scored seven times in the Champions League. He helped Portsmouth win the Championship in season 2002-03, and then scored 16 goals for them in the Premier League in 2003-04, four of them against Middlesbrough.

He scored another 13 Premier League goals the following season, after which he moved to Middlesbrough for £7.5 million. He scored 23 goals in 75 appearances for Boro and helped them reach the 2006 UEFA Cup final.

He then moved on to Everton for £11.25 million, and in his stay at Goodison Park took his goals tally in England to over 100.

He had a brief spell on loan at Leicester, before he moved on to Blackburn in 2011. He scored 18 goals for them including all four against Swansea City, but left when they were relegated.

After that, he played in China and for Reading, Kayserispor and Coventry City before retiring in November 2017.

For his country, Yakubu has played in the 2000 Olympic Games, 2002 and 2004 African Cup of Nations and the 2010 World Cup.
